Plant Community Walk: Devil's Punchbowl

Image credit: Deseree Audette

Join us for a casual, educational botany walk at Devil’s Punchbowl Natural Area. This fantastic geological wonder exists where desert, montane and chaparral plant communities collide. The park and it’s wonderful visitor center burned in the Bobcat Fire in 2020, but much of the ecology is in recovery. Some noteworthy plants which characterize the area include Flannel Bush, Joshua Tree, Juniper and Pinyon Pine.

Plant Community Walk - Santa Susana Pass

Join us for a casual walk in Santa Susana State Historic Park where PCLA Director Parker Davis will lead our group through this surreal setting characterized by cretaceous era sandstone boulders and sagescrub, including a unique subspecies of monkeyflower only found in this location.
